Certain varieties of tools require a number of cylinders to increase and retract concurrently in a process generally known as synchronization. However, synchronizing cylinder movements just isn't always essentially the most easy course of. Two principal strategies are used to create synchronized hydraulic systems: tying the cylinders together utilizing mechanical hardware or using sensible sensors to create a completely computerized place-sensing system. For instance, in massive-scale farming operations, hydraulic cylinders are used in crop-loading techniques to efficiently transfer crops from the sphere to storage or transport automobiles. They're also crucial in automated irrigation methods, the place they help in raising and lowering floodgates to manage water circulate. In soil tilling, hydraulic cylinders are used to operate plows and different soil preparation instruments, ensuring they dig deep and huge to prepare the land for planting.

What are Common Concerns with Synchronizing Hydraulic Cylinders Utilizing Sensors? The top concern with choosing smart sensors for synchronizing hydraulic cylinders is the higher buying price. For OEMs and manufacturers with budget as a priority, mechanical synchronization will be tempting as these systems are cheaper to put in. Nevertheless, sensors greater than compensate for the higher buying price by reliable readings, automatic synchronization correction, and more.
